Frequently Asked Questions

How do Midwest College of Oriental Medicine-Racine and University of Wisconsin-Parkside compare?
Midwest College of Oriental Medicine-Racine (Racine, WI) has no published acceptance rate, in-state tuition of —, and median 10-year earnings of $44,136. University of Wisconsin-Parkside (Kenosha, WI) has an acceptance rate of 75.4%, in-state tuition of $8,270, and median 10-year earnings of $51,129.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, Midwest College of Oriental Medicine-Racine or University of Wisconsin-Parkside?
University of Wisconsin-Parkside gra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$51,129 vs $44,136.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
